Appeal

When three prosecutors are assassinated outside a bar in their small Arkansas town, the team is called in to determine if this was a personal vendetta; Ray feels compelled to help a woman and her young son combat an injustice.

  • Dark and Troubled Past: Ray reveals to Hana how he grew up enduring bigotry and prejudice as a black man.
  • Domestic Abuse: When the team speaks with Roarke's ex-wife Cynthia, she reveals bruises she received from him.
  • Karmic Death: Roarke is a bigoted Angry White Man targeting those he held responsible for ruining his chances for a higher judicial post. He gets killed via Boom, Headshot! by a black state trooper.
  • Kill and Replace: Roarke kills a hospital technician named Chip Fox to steal the latter's ID so he can kill Governor Nancy Novak. They both look alike (bald Caucasian men in their early 50s with hazel eyes) so Chip's coworkers were none the wiser when Roarke appeared in Chip's place with a face mask and Chip's glasses.
  • Killed Offscreen: Skip Hardy and Chip Fox were both killed by Roarke off-screen.
  • Straight Gay: The hacker Samuel Grey has a boyfriend named Eric.
  • The Resenter: Roarke is angry that his former law school classmates and colleagues have worked their way up to higher judicial offices while he was stuck on circuit court bench. As revealed by his former colleague and friend Arthur Hobbs, Roarke had applied for an open vacancy at the Arkansas Court of Appeals, but was denied due to JNE (Judicial Nominees Evaluation) surveys revealing allegations of sexual harassment, bribes, and improper bias. Instead of taking responsibility, Roarke took his rage out on the people he thinks halted his success because of their own.
